Renewable electricity in Rwanda
Rwanda: Renewable electricity was 56.9% in 2015. ▼ Falling
Renewable electricity in Rwanda, 1990–2015
Source: World Bank and International Energy Agency (IEA Statistics © OECD/IEA, http://www.iea.org/stats/index.asp). Measured in % in total electricity output.
Analysis
In 2015, renewable electricity in Rwanda stood at 56.9%.
That represents a change of up 29.1% on the previous year and up 2.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, renewable electricity in Rwanda peaked at 98.3% in 2003 and was at its lowest, 22.5%, in 2006.
Rwanda ranks 52nd of 230 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 26 years of available data.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 97.4% | 96.9% | 97.7% | 10 |
| 2000s | 63.0% | 22.5% | 98.3% | 10 |
| 2010s | 44.4% | 35.9% | 56.9% | 6 |
